Quality Assurance Specialist I


This is an onsite, in-office position at Geneoscopy HQ in St. Louis, Missouri.

The Quality Assurance Specialist I assists in ensuring that Geneoscopy's products and services meet the requirements of the Quality Management System while maintaining and managing the Company's document control system to ensure compliance with both the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ments (CLIA) and the Quality System Regulation (21 CFR 820).

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Assist in maintaining compliance with all applicable regulations and requirements (CLIA, CAP, NYS DOH, FDA, ISO, etc.).
  • Maintain the process for document control, including document creation, revision, and obsolescence.
  • Ensure documents are approved by the appropriate personnel in accordance with applicable policies and procedures.
  • Gather document requirements and details, ensuring documents are formatted in a consistent way and all aspects of the document control process are completed.
  • Maintain paper and electronic files so they are well-organized and easily retrievable.
  • Manage periodic document reviews to ensure adherence to internal procedures.
  • Assist users in navigating and effectively utilizing the electronic Quality Management System (eQMS).
    • Conduct training sessions for staff on the use and understanding of the eQMS as necessary.
  • Manage the document control module in the eQMS, including evaluations of updates and software validation as needed.
  • Participate in internal and external audits.
  • Coordinate quality processes.
  • Assist the Safety Officer with administrative safety tasks as necessary.
  • Participate in Management Review meetings.
  • Perform work under general supervision, navigating moderately complex issues and problems.
  • Exemplify solid working knowledge of the subject matter.
  • Other duties as assigned.
